Lin Qiran, a female college student who was about to graduate for internship, was anxious to find an internship job to meet the school's requirements. She went out for breakfast early that day, complaining about the school's unreasonable demands and recent bad luck. While she was riding a shared bicycle, while waiting at a red light, a recruitment advertisement flew in her face, and the gears of fate began to turn...
